👉 Hybrid Cloud Deployment Strategies: Pros, Cons, and Best Fits

 

In today's digital landscape, businesses are increasingly turning to hybrid cloud deployment strategies to meet their diverse computing needs. But what exactly does that mean? And what are the various types of hybrid cloud deployments? Let's break it down in simple terms.

Understanding Hybrid Cloud Deployment

Before delving into the different types of hybrid cloud deployment strategies, let's first grasp the concept of hybrid cloud itself. In essence, a hybrid cloud combines elements of both public and private clouds, allowing organizations to leverage the benefits of both models. This blend offers greater flexibility, scalability, and control over IT resources.

Types of Hybrid Cloud Deployment Strategies

  1. Vertical Hybrid Cloud

Vertical hybrid cloud deployment involves the segregation of workloads based on their sensitivity and regulatory requirements. In this setup, sensitive data and critical applications are hosted on the private cloud, while less sensitive workloads are placed in the public cloud. This strategy offers enhanced security and compliance for sensitive data, making it ideal for industries like finance and healthcare.

Pros:

    • Enhanced security: Critical data remains on-premises or within a private cloud environment, reducing the risk of unauthorized access.
    • Compliance adherence: Helps organizations comply with industry regulations and data protection laws.
    • Customization: Allows for tailored security measures and configurations to meet specific compliance requirements.

Cons:

    • Complexity: Managing multiple environments can be complex and require specialized expertise.
    • Cost: Setting up and maintaining a private cloud infrastructure can be costly.

Best for: 

Industries handling sensitive data, such as finance, healthcare, and government agencies.

  1. Horizontal Hybrid Cloud

Unlike vertical hybrid cloud deployment, horizontal hybrid cloud focuses on workload distribution based on resource requirements and performance metrics. In this model, workloads are dynamically allocated between public and private clouds based on factors like processing power, storage capacity, and network bandwidth.

Pros:

    • Optimized performance: Workloads can be dynamically scaled across different environments to meet fluctuating demand.
    • Cost-efficiency: Allows organizations to leverage the cost advantages of public cloud services while retaining control over critical workloads.
    • Scalability: Offers the flexibility to scale resources up or down as needed, ensuring optimal performance and cost-effectiveness.

Cons:

    • Dependency on network connectivity: Relies heavily on network connectivity for seamless workload migration and data transfer.
    • Integration challenges: Ensuring compatibility and seamless integration between public and private cloud environments can be challenging.

Best for: 

Organizations with fluctuating workloads and dynamic resource requirements, such as e-commerce platforms and seasonal businesses.

  1. Distributed Hybrid Cloud

Distributed hybrid cloud deployment takes a decentralized approach, spreading workloads across multiple public and private cloud environments. This strategy aims to optimize performance, reliability, and data sovereignty by distributing workloads closer to end-users or specific geographic regions.

Pros:

    • Improved performance: Reduces latency and improves response times by placing workloads closer to end-users or data sources.
    • Enhanced reliability: Redundant deployment across multiple environments reduces the risk of downtime and ensures high availability.
    • Data sovereignty: Enables organizations to comply with data residency requirements by keeping data within specific geographic regions or jurisdictions.

Cons:

    • Management complexity: Requires robust management and orchestration tools to oversee distributed workloads across multiple environments.
    • Cost implications: Managing redundant deployments across multiple environments can incur additional costs.

Best for: 

Global enterprises with geographically dispersed operations and stringent performance requirements, such as multinational corporations and content delivery networks (CDNs).

  1. Multi-Cloud Hybrid Deployment

Multi-cloud hybrid deployment involves leveraging multiple public cloud providers to distribute workloads across different cloud environments. This strategy offers redundancy, vendor diversity, and flexibility, allowing organizations to avoid vendor lock-in and mitigate the risk of service outages.

Pros:

    • Vendor diversity: Reduces reliance on a single cloud provider and mitigates the risk of vendor lock-in.
    • Redundancy: Distributing workloads across multiple cloud platforms enhances fault tolerance and resilience.
    • Flexibility: Allows organizations to choose the best-in-class services from different cloud providers to meet specific requirements.

Cons:

    • Complexity: Managing multiple cloud providers can introduce complexity in terms of billing, governance, and security.
    • Interoperability challenges: Ensuring compatibility and seamless integration between different cloud platforms can be challenging.

Best for: 

Enterprises seeking to maximize flexibility, resilience, and avoid vendor lock-in by leveraging the strengths of multiple cloud providers.

  1. Hybrid Cloud Bursting

Hybrid cloud bursting combines the scalability of public cloud resources with the control and security of a private cloud environment. In this model, organizations maintain a baseline workload on-premises or in a private cloud and leverage public cloud resources during peak demand periods.

Pros:

    • Scalability: Allows organizations to seamlessly scale resources up or down in response to fluctuating demand without overprovisioning on-premises infrastructure.
    • Cost optimization: Helps reduce costs by only paying for additional resources when needed, rather than maintaining excess capacity.
    • High availability: Ensures continuous service availability even during peak demand periods by leveraging public cloud resources.

Cons:

    • Data transfer costs: Moving data between on-premises and public cloud environments can incur additional costs, especially for large datasets.
    • Integration complexity: Requires robust orchestration and automation tools to facilitate seamless workload migration between environments.

Best for: 

Organizations with unpredictable or seasonal workloads, such as retail, e-commerce, and media streaming platforms.

  1. Community Cloud Hybrid Deployment

Community cloud hybrid deployment involves sharing computing resources and infrastructure among multiple organizations with similar interests, such as industry regulations, compliance requirements, or security concerns. This model offers the benefits of both public and private clouds while fostering collaboration and resource sharing within a specific community.

Pros:

    • Cost sharing: Allows organizations to pool resources and infrastructure, reducing individual costs and overhead.
    • Compliance adherence: Helps organizations comply with industry regulations and security standards specific to their community.
    • Resource optimization: Enables efficient resource utilization by sharing infrastructure among community members.

Cons:

    • Limited scalability: The size and scalability of the community cloud may be limited, depending on the number of participating organizations.
    • Dependency on community cooperation: Relies on cooperation and trust among community members to effectively manage and secure shared resources.

Best for: 

Industries or sectors with common regulatory or compliance requirements, such as government agencies, healthcare providers, or educational institutions.

  1. Containerized Hybrid Cloud Deployment

Containerized hybrid cloud deployment leverages containerization technologies such as Docker and Kubernetes to facilitate the seamless movement of applications and workloads across different cloud environments. Containers encapsulate applications and their dependencies, enabling consistent deployment and scalability across hybrid cloud infrastructure.

Pros:

    • Portability: Containers enable applications to run consistently across different cloud environments, simplifying deployment and management.
    • Scalability: Container orchestration platforms like Kubernetes automate the scaling of containerized workloads based on demand, improving resource utilization and responsiveness.
    • Resource efficiency: Containers consume fewer resources compared to traditional virtual machines, maximizing infrastructure utilization and cost-efficiency.

Cons:

    • Learning curve: Adopting containerization technologies requires a learning curve for development and operations teams, potentially leading to initial productivity challenges.
    • Management complexity: Managing containerized workloads across hybrid cloud environments requires robust orchestration and management tools to ensure reliability and performance.

Best for: 

Organizations embracing DevOps practices and microservices architecture, seeking to achieve greater agility, scalability, and portability across hybrid cloud infrastructure.

  1. Edge Computing Hybrid Deployment

Edge computing hybrid deployment extends cloud computing capabilities to the network edge, closer to where data is generated and consumed. This model enables real-time processing and analysis of data, reducing latency and bandwidth requirements while enhancing privacy and security.

Pros:

    • Low latency: By processing data closer to the source, edge computing reduces latency and improves responsiveness for latency-sensitive applications.
    • Bandwidth optimization: Edge computing reduces the volume of data transmitted to centralized cloud data centers, minimizing bandwidth requirements and costs.
    • Improved privacy and security: Edge computing keeps sensitive data localized, reducing exposure to security threats and compliance risks associated with data movement.

Cons:

    • Infrastructure complexity: Deploying and managing edge computing infrastructure at scale can be complex, requiring specialized expertise and investment in hardware and networking infrastructure.
    • Interoperability challenges: Ensuring interoperability and compatibility between edge devices and centralized cloud infrastructure can be challenging, requiring standardization and integration efforts.

Best for: 

Industries requiring real-time processing and analysis of data, such as IoT, autonomous vehicles, and industrial automation, as well as organizations operating in remote or bandwidth-constrained environments.

Frequently Asked Questions:

You might be interested to explore the following  most related queries;

  1. What is a hybrid cloud?
  2. What are the benefits of a hybrid cloud?
  3. What are the drawbacks of a hybrid cloud?
  4. How does a hybrid cloud differ from a public cloud or private cloud?
  5. What are the security considerations for a hybrid cloud?
  6. How can I migrate my data to a hybrid cloud?
  7. What are the different types of hybrid cloud solutions?
  8. What are the costs associated with using a hybrid cloud?
  9. What are the top hybrid cloud service providers?
  10. What is the role of containers in a hybrid cloud environment?
  11. How to manage costs in a hybrid cloud?
  12. Hybrid-Cloud 101: A Comprehensive Guide for Beginners in 2024
  13. Double Your Storage Efficiency | 12 + Crucial Hybrid Cloud FAQs You Can't Ignore

Conclusion

In conclusion, hybrid cloud deployment strategies offer organizations a flexible and scalable approach to managing their IT infrastructure. Whether you prioritize security, performance, or cost-efficiency, there's a hybrid cloud strategy that can meet your specific needs. By understanding the pros, cons, and best fits of each type, you can make informed decisions and leverage the power of hybrid cloud to drive innovation and growth in your business.

 

Previous Post Next Post

Welcome to WebStryker.Com